1. Smartphones and Accessories
The smartphone industry shows no signs of slowing down. In 2025, demand for both smartphones and related accessories (like cases, chargers, and screen protectors) is expected to remain strong. As technology evolves, consumers are seeking devices with greater functionality, higher performance, and better design.
2. Wearable Technology
Wearable technology, including smartwatches and fitness trackers, is rapidly gaining popularity. By 2025, the global market for wearables is projected to grow significantly. Exporting wearable devices can be a lucrative opportunity for businesses looking to capitalize on health-conscious trends and tech-savvy consumers.
3. Smart Home Devices
Smart home technology is transforming the way people live. Products like smart speakers, smart thermostats, and security systems are increasingly sought after. Offering smart home devices for export can tap into the growing trend of home automation and energy efficiency.
4. Drones
Drones have found applications in various industries, from agriculture to real estate. As regulations become more favorable, the export of consumer and commercial drones is expected to expand. Businesses focusing on drone technology can benefit from this growing market.
5. Electric Vehicles (EVs)
The shift towards sustainable transportation is facilitating a surge in demand for electric vehicles. With governments promoting environmentally friendly options, exporting EVs and their components can become a profitable venture in 2025.
6. Gaming Consoles
The gaming industry continues to thrive as more people engage in digital entertainment. New gaming consoles and accessories will be in high demand as technology advances. Exporting gaming consoles offers a pathway to reach a global market filled with avid gamers.
7. Televisions and Smart Displays
With advancements such as 8K-resolution and OLED technology, televisions have become essential entertainment devices. Consumers expect cutting-edge features in smart displays. Exporting these high-demand electronics is a smart move for businesses looking to capitalize on the growing home entertainment sector.
Strategies for Successful Electronics Export
To ensure that you successfully navigate international markets, consider the following strategies:
- Market Research: Always conduct thorough research to identify target markets for your electronics.
- Quality Assurance: Ensure that your products meet the necessary quality and compliance standards.
- Establish Partnerships: Build strong relationships with distributors and retailers in your target markets.
- Marketing Strategy: Develop a comprehensive marketing strategy that highlights the unique features of your products.
